296 Euura imperfecta ( Zaddach, 1876)
Figs 311 View Figs 309–312 , 535 View Figs 534–545
Nematus imperfectus Zaddach, 1876: 73 , 80–81. Syntypes ♀♀, probably destroyed ( Blank & Taeger 1998). Type localities: Germany, Finland, Scotland and Poland.
Pachynematus imperfectus var. claristernis Enslin, 1916a: 484 . Lectotype designated below. Synonymy by Taeger et al. (2010).
Pachynematus (Larinematus) tatricus Roller & Haris, 2008: 47–49 . Syn. nov.
Diagnosis
Small subapical tooth of claws, colouration (male largely black; in female, pterostigma basally paler than apically, abdomen dorsally black, metafemur at least partly pale), structure of valvula 3 (in dorsal view rather broad, not tapering, and posteriorly with invagination) and penis valve enable separation of the species from the other Euura . The shape of valvula 3 varies somewhat, but there is no clear gap in variability and apparently no correlation with variability in mesepisternum colouration (from completely black to completely pale).

Genetics
COI
Based on 5 specimens, maximum within-species distance is 2.28% and the nearest neighbour, diverging by a minimum of 5.78%, is Euura hulteni .
Nuclear
Based on 3 specimens, maximum within-species distance is 1.2% (0.31% based on haplotypes of individual females). The nearest neighbour, diverging by a minimum of 2.87%, is Euura villosa .
Distribution and material examined
Palaearctic. Specimens studied are from Austria, Finland, Germany, and Russia.
